E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
service单元测试
关于提高复杂业务逻辑代码可读性的思考
目录前言需求场景常规写法拆分方法领域对象总结前言实际工作中大部分时间都是在写业务逻辑,一般都是三层架构,表示层(Controller)接收客户端请求,并对入参做检验,业务逻辑层(
Service
)负责处理业务逻辑
编程经验分享
·
2024-09-16 10:51
开发经验
java
数据库
开发语言
openssl+keepalived安装部署
文章目录OpenSSL安装下载地址编译安装修改系统配置版本Keepalived安装下载地址安装遇到问题安装完成配置文件keepalived运行检查运行状态查看系统日志修改服务
service
重新加载systemd
_小亦_
·
2024-09-16 08:08
项目部署
keepalived
openssl
多线程之——ExecutorCompletion
Service
本文介绍一个简单处理这种情况的方法:直接上代码:publicclassExecutorCompletion
Service
Test{@TestpublicvoidtestExecutorCo
阿福德
·
2024-09-16 07:35
ubuntu安装wordpress
如果修改了一些配置可以使用下列命令重启一下systemctlrestartnginx.
service
2安装mysql输入安装前也可以更新一下软件源,在安装过程中将会让你输入数据库的密码。
lissettecarlr
·
2024-09-16 05:51
Python 课程10-
单元测试
前言在现代软件开发中,
单元测试
已成为一种必不可少的实践。通过测试,我们可以确保每个功能模块在开发和修改过程中按预期工作,从而减少软件缺陷,提高代码质量。
可愛小吉
·
2024-09-16 05:17
Python教學
python
单元测试
开发语言
TDD
unittest
华为云分布式缓存服务DCS 8月新特性发布
分布式缓存服务(DistributedCache
Service
,简称DCS)是华为云提供的一款兼容Redis的高速内存数据处理引擎,为您提供即开即用、安全可靠、弹性扩容、便捷管理的在线分布式缓存能力,满足用户高并发及数据快速访问的业务诉求
华为云PaaS服务小智
·
2024-09-16 04:43
华为云
分布式
缓存
metaRTC/webRTC QOS 方案与实践
概述质量服务(QOS/Qualityof
Service
)是指利用各种技术方案提高网络通信质量的技术,网络通信质量需要解决下面两个问题:网络问题:UDP/不稳定网络/弱网下的丢包/延时/乱序/抖动数据量问题
metaRTC
·
2024-09-16 02:31
metaRTC
解决方案
webrtc
qos
Istio pilot-discovery服务发现源码解析(1.13版本)
Istiopilot-discovery服务发现介绍工作机制初始化初始化Config控制器初始化
Service
控制器controller初始化Namespace
Service
NodePodPilotDiscovery
xidianjiapei001
·
2024-09-16 02:54
#
Istio
istio
云原生
服务发现
Ubuntu常用命令整理
22端口没有打开,开启ssh服务:安装openssh-serversudoapt-getinstallopenssh-server检查安装是否成功sudops-e|grepssh开启ssh服务sudo
service
sshstartUbuntu
十里染林
·
2024-09-16 01:56
关闭Windows自动更新的6种方法
通过服务管理器:打开“服务”管理器,可以通过在运行对话框中输入
service
s.msc来打开。找
Gemini1995
·
2024-09-16 00:16
windows
【Kubernetes】常见面试题汇总(十一)
(1)对于Kubernetes,集群外的客户端默认情况,无法通过Pod的IP地址或者
Service
的虚拟IP地址:虚拟端口号进行访问。(2)通常可以通过以下方式进行访问Kubernetes集群
summer.335
·
2024-09-16 00:14
Kubernetes
kubernetes
容器
云原生
k8s中
Service
暴露的种类以及用法
一、说明在Kubernetes中,有几种不同的方式可以将服务(
Service
)暴露给外部流量。这些方式通过定义服务的spec.type字段来确定。
听说唐僧不吃肉
·
2024-09-16 00:13
K8S
kubernetes
容器
云原生
228.第一个错误的版本
你可以通过调用boolisBadVersion(version)接口来判断版本号version是否在
单元测试
中出错。实现一个函数来查找第一个错
vbuer
·
2024-09-15 22:19
SPI机制
1、SPI机制:
Service
ProviderInterface:服务提供发现机制,类型IOCJavaSPI实现:
Service
Loader定义接口A;实现接口A的实现类,B和C;在/META-INF/
我们仍未知道那天所看见的猫的名
·
2024-09-15 22:16
webstorm报错TypeError: this.cliEngine is not a constructor
this.cliEngineisnotaconstructoratESLintPlugin.invokeESLint(/Applications/RubyMine.app/Contents/plugins/JavaScriptLanguage/language
Service
Blue_Color
·
2024-09-15 20:50
linux挂载文件夹
检查是否安装NFSrpm-qa|grepnfs2.启动和启用NFS服务假设服务名称为nfs-server.
service
,你可以使用以下命令启动和启用它:sudosystemctlstartnfs-server.
service
sudosystemctlenablenf
小码快撩
·
2024-09-15 19:58
linux
Spring @Async 深度解读:默认线程池执行器的配置与优化
@Async通常用于标注在需要异步执行的方法上,比如:@
Service
publicclass
小码快撩
·
2024-09-15 19:28
spring
java
前端
Spring Security定义多个过滤器链(10)
我们来看如下一个案例:@ConfigurationpublicclassSecurityConfig{@BeanUserDetails
Service
us(){InMemoryUserDetailsManagerusers
小黑屋说YYDS
·
2024-09-15 17:13
spring
C# 自动化
实现的方法可能很笨,但是确实很好用usingSystem;usingSystem.Collections.Generic;usingSystem.Linq;usingSystem.Runtime.Interop
Service
s
TineAine
·
2024-09-15 14:29
C#
代码片段
自动化
c#
自动化
模拟操作
MyBatis 查询数据库_mybatis查询某个库的所有表名(2)
####2.4.4添加
Service
服务层实现代码如下:@
2401_84181942
·
2024-09-15 14:57
程序员
mybatis
oracle
tomcat
5-【JavaWeb】JUnit
单元测试
及JUL 日志系统
1.使用JUnit进行
单元测试
JUnit是Java中非常流行的
单元测试
框架,MyBatis与JUnit可以很好地结合,来测试持久层代码的正确性。
weixin_44329069
·
2024-09-15 13:23
JavaWeb
junit
单元测试
关于测试的个人理解
针对测试,专业的知识可以自行百度我只谈谈我目前的理解:我目前理解的测试包含两方面:
单元测试
和集成测试我理解的
单元测试
是,以一个类的一个方法的
单元测试
为例,我只关心方法是要干什么的,输入是什么,预期输出是什么
低调_0c1d
·
2024-09-15 13:38
Spring Cloud: Hystrix请求队列线程不足
我们遇到了这样一个错误:"...,stacktrace:[com.netflix.hystrix.exception.HystrixRuntimeException:QueryNodeImpalaBd
Service
MeazZa
·
2024-09-15 12:48
Servlet容器的作用、HttpServlet的工作机制流程图
HttpServletRequest解析过程是否GETPOST其他方法Servlet生命周期init-初始化Servlet
service
-处理请求destroy-销毁ServletgetMethod返回
烟雨国度
·
2024-09-15 12:31
servlet
流程图
hive
车载以太网之SOME/IP
整体介绍SOME/IP(全称为:Scalable
service
-OrientedMiddlewarEoverIP),是运行在车载以太网协议栈基础之上的中间件,或者也可以称为应用层软件。
IT_码农
·
2024-09-15 10:20
车载以太网
车载以太网
SOME/IP
Android-悬浮窗功能的实现(附Java、KT实现源码)(1)
//获取服务的操作对象valbinder=
service
asFloatWinfow
Service
s.MyBinderbinder.
service
}overridefunon
Service
Disconnected
egrhef
·
2024-09-15 07:57
程序员
android
java
开发语言
Camera2 Camera
Service
启动
main_mediaserver.cppframeworks/av/media/mediaserver/Android.bpframeworks/native/include/binder/Binder
Service
.hframeworks
yaoming168
·
2024-09-15 03:02
Camera
Framewrok
android
深入理解
单元测试
作为一名软件开发工程师,你应该对
单元测试
(unittest)很熟悉,但
单元测试
的目的、Mock的正确用法、
单元测试
和集成测试的区别等等,你真的懂吗?
元闰子
·
2024-09-15 01:17
单元测试
log4j
手撸vue3核心源码——响应式原理(isRef和unRef)
ref的功能函数,isRef与unRefisRefisRef和isReactive一样,都是用于检测数据类型,isRef是检测是不是一个ref对象,跟isReactive函数实现起来一样,我们先来写一个
单元测试
这里要实现的功能是
前端不是渣男
·
2024-09-14 22:20
前端
vue.js
编程小技巧
6、
单元测试
总是合算的。7、不要先写框架再写实现。最好反过来,从原型中提炼框架。8、代码结构清晰,其它问题都不算事儿。9、好的项目作
风的低语
·
2024-09-14 19:25
Springboot3 整合 Mybatis3
MybatisSpringboot3整合Mybatis一、导入依赖二、编写配置文件三、定义模型entity实体类四、在启动类上添加注解,表示mapper接口所在位置五、定义mapper接口六、定义mapper.xml映射文件七、
service
(前程似锦)
·
2024-09-14 17:22
mybatis
java
spring
boot
实现多级缓存的六种策略方法
步骤:更新数据库删除或失效缓存publicclassCache
Service
{privateLocalCachelocalCache;privateRedisCacheredisCache;private
Kixuan214
·
2024-09-14 17:50
缓存
redis
rabbitmq
SpringBoot项目
数据库链接实现);(这个命名,有人喜欢用Dao命名,有人喜欢用Mapper,看个人习惯了吧)(2)Bean层:也叫model层,模型层,entity层,实体层,就是数据库表的映射实体类,存放POJO对象;(3)
Service
俺叫啥好嘞
·
2024-09-14 14:28
spring系列
spring
springboot
java中的ide、sdk是什么,javaee\javase\javame区别
ide:integrateddevelopmentenvironment集成开发环境简单的来说就是提供编译代码等一系列功能的开发环境比如:eclipsesdk:
service
developmentpack
极客Thomas
·
2024-09-14 13:54
ide
java
eclipse
K8S - Volume - NFS 卷的简介和使用
emptydirk8s-Volume简介和HostPath的使用K8S-Emptydir-取代ELK使用fluentd构建loggingsaidcar但是这两种卷都有同1个限制,就是依赖于k8snodes的空间如果某个
service
pod
nvd11
·
2024-09-14 11:13
K8S
kubernetes
容器
云原生
K8S - Emptydir - 取代ELK 使用fluentd 构建logging saidcar
由于k8s的无状态
service
通常部署在多个POD中,实现多实例面向高并发。
nvd11
·
2024-09-14 10:38
K8S
kubernetes
LSP协议被劫持导致不能上网
原因分析:WinsockLSP全称WindowsSocketLayered
Service
Provider(分层服务提供商),它是Windows底层网络Socker通信需要经
tgl182
·
2024-09-14 10:03
LSP协议
Wi-Fi基础术语
accesspoint,即无线接入点,是一个无线网络的创建者,是网络的中心节点;无线路由器就是一个APSTA:station,指每一个连接到无线网络中的终端设备都可以称为一个站点IBSS:IndependentBasic
Service
Set
madmanazo
·
2024-09-14 10:31
Hardware
.net6 SqlSugar配置及增删改查(webapi项目)
NuGet包:1.SqlSugarCore2.System.Data.SqlClientProgram配置:builder.
Service
s.AddScoped(x=>{SqlSugarClientdb
潘小白梦想进大厂
·
2024-09-14 06:40
SqlSugar
.net
数据库
AWS Nitro架构简介
AWS(AmazonWeb
Service
s)Nitro架构为Amazon的云服务提供了底层的支持。
河马虚拟化
·
2024-09-14 06:03
计算机架构
虚拟化
aws
虚拟机
架构
AWS
Service
Catalog Terraform 参考架构教程
AWS
Service
CatalogTerraform参考架构教程aws-
service
-catalog-terraform-reference-architectureApplyTerraformconfigurationsusingCloudFormationthroughaproxylambda
杜腾金Beguiling
·
2024-09-14 06:03
测者的测试技术手册:Junit执行
单元测试
用例成功,mvn test却失败的问题和解决方法
RunUnitTest和Maventest的区别差异1:在IDE中通过选中
单元测试
路径,点击右键选择runtest和点击maven中的test是有区别的。
Criss陈磊
·
2024-09-14 04:20
三十五、Gin注册功能实战
目录一、创建请求组二、
service
下创建register.go文件三、实现密码加密功能四、在register方法中使用encryptPassword函数一、创建请求组const(rootPath="/
Boo_T
·
2024-09-14 03:49
go
gin
golang
开发语言
后端
Ubuntu 22.04网络无法连接的解决方法
sudo
service
NetworkManagerstopsudorm/var/lib/NetworkManager/NetworkManager.statesudoserv
威桑
·
2024-09-14 03:19
Linux
ubuntu
linux
搭建ftp服务器
1搭建ftp服务器yuminstallvsftpd*-y安装vsftpd服务rpm-qlvsftpd|more查看安装路径systemctlrestartvsftpd.
service
启用vsftp服务ps-ef
哆啦A梦_ca52
·
2024-09-14 02:12
kubernetes里面那些事————控制器
无状态应用部署2.2,DaemonSet:确保所有Node运行同一个pod2.3,StatefulSet:有状态应用部署2.4,Job:一次性任务2.5,CronJob:定时任务2.6,pod2.7,
service
2.8
背锅攻城师
·
2024-09-13 23:50
kubernetes
kubernetes
容器
云原生
dubbo整合nacos(狠狠踩坑 之 自己淋过雨不想让别人也一起)
狠狠踩坑,这个东西搞了好久~~~2.消费服务和提供服务都加上依赖org.apache.dubbodubbo3.0.9com.alibaba.nacosnacos-client2.1.03.创建一个Demo
Service
程序员-珍
·
2024-09-13 22:48
dubbo
微服务
spring
boot
java
后端
ubuntu安装 Apache 服务器 实现局域网浏览器访问文件
default.confsudovi/etc/apache2/apache2.conf重启sudo/etc/init.d/apache2restart允许外部访问Apache端口sudoufwallow|deny[
service
云樱梦海
·
2024-09-13 21:44
2021-04-06笔试
1.用图画出产品研发周期中软件测试的不同阶段,并加以适当描述
单元测试
、集成测试、系统测试、验收测试
单元测试
:系统最小可测试的单元集成测试:将各个单元连接起来,穿插接口数据是否受到影响系统测试:范围包括-
嘿_叫我小王
·
2024-09-13 21:59
Spring 在多线程环境下如何确保事务一致性
小结问题在现我先把问题抛出来,大家就明白本文目的在于解决什么样的业务痛点了:public void removeAuthorityModuleSeq(Integer authorityModuleId, IAuthority
Service
「已注销」
·
2024-09-13 20:38
SpringBoot
spring
mysql
java
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他